What is Blepharoplasty?

Blepharoplasty is a surgical procedure that is designed to improve the appearance of the eyelids by removing excess skin, fat, and muscle from the upper and/or lower eyelids. The procedure can be used to address a variety of issues, including:

Sagging or drooping eyelids

Puffy bags under the eyes

Fine lines and wrinkles around the eyes

Vision problems caused by sagging eyelids

The eyelid lift procedure is typically performed on an outpatient basis under local anesthesia and can take anywhere from one to three hours, depending on the extent of the surgery.

How Long Does Blepharoplasty Last?

The longevity of the results of blepharoplasty can vary from person to person, and there are several factors that can impact how long the effects of the surgery will last.

Age: The effects of blepharoplasty tend to last longer in younger patients, as their skin is more elastic and able to bounce back more easily after surgery.

Genetics: The rate at which a person’s skin ages is largely determined by genetics, so patients with good skin elasticity may experience longer-lasting results.

Lifestyle factors: Smoking, sun exposure, and poor diet can all contribute to premature aging of the skin, which can impact the longevity of the results of blepharoplasty.

Severity of the issue: Patients with more severe signs of aging around the eyes may require more extensive surgery, which can impact the longevity of the results.

In general, the effects of blepharoplasty can last anywhere from five to 10 years or more, depending on the factors listed above. However, it is important to note that the procedure does not stop the aging process, and patients will continue to age after the surgery.

Maintaining the Results of Blepharoplasty

While the effects of blepharoplasty may not be permanent, there are steps that patients can take to maintain the results of the surgery for as long as possible.

Practice good skincare: Using a quality moisturizer and sunscreen can help protect the delicate skin around the eyes from sun damage and premature aging.

Quit smoking: Smoking can accelerate the aging process and contribute to wrinkles and sagging skin, so quitting smoking is an important step in maintaining the results of blepharoplasty.

Maintain a healthy lifestyle: Eating a healthy diet, staying hydrated, and getting regular exercise can all help keep the skin looking healthy and youthful.

Consider non-surgical treatments: Patients who want to extend the results of blepharoplasty may want to consider non-surgical treatments such as Botox or fillers, which can help smooth out wrinkles and fine lines around the eyes.
